- [ ] Step 7: Archive cold storage buckets (Glacierline tier). Confirm both ceremony witnesses are present, verify bucket manifests match the Oxbow ledger, then seal the archive key shares. Plugin authors may observe but not handle shares. Once sealed, the archive index itself is encrypted and can only be reopened with the passphrase below.

vault phrase of badup-hahig = tamael-aldael-kelmir-istael-fenok-istwyn-tamius-jorath-oliion

Subject: Key rotation — Switchloom flag service

Team,

Ahead of the weekly sync: we rotated credentials for Switchloom, our feature-flag rollout framework, after the quarterly audit. Old keys stop working Friday at noon. Please update any local harnesses that evaluate flags against the staging control plane. Rollout percentages and targeting rules are unaffected. The new staging key is provided below.

gateway credential: kto23_dolYgAScEh2TaPOlStqOl98

### Checklist item 14 — Tile-rendering cache layer (Cartavel Maps)

Confirm the new tile cache in Cartavel's renderer does not persist tiles containing user-drawn annotation layers; those must remain request-scoped. Verify cache keys exclude session identifiers and that eviction honors the 6-hour TTL on the shared node pool in the Ostmere cluster. Security sign-off required before promotion to staging. The validated artifact is identified by the token below.

trace token, kahog-tajeg: htk6_97d963

## Releases

Bouncehound (our email bounce processor) ships on a two-week cadence. Tag the release, let the Fennwick pipeline build and sign the artifacts, then sanity-check the bounce-classification smoke tests before promoting. Don't hand-roll builds — signing happens in CI only. If verification fails downstream, the key is probably stale on their end. Current releases verify against the key below.

deploy key for kahof-tadup: bky4_rRMZ

**Mgmt Meeting Minutes — Retiring the Brightline Range**

Quick recap for sales leads at Fenholt Supplies: we agreed to retire the Brightline fixture range by year-end. Remaining stock moves to clearance pricing next month, and accounts on standing orders get migrated to the Lumetta range. Trade-in incentives were approved in principle. The confidential note on next steps sits just below.

board note of bajof-bajeg: The pricing group signed off on a budget of $13.4 million for Project Sildor. The renewal with Lamixek Holdings closes at $48.9 million a year, 49 percent above the last contract.